import { Construct } from 'constructs';
import * as cdktf from 'cdktf';
export interface ComputeHealthCheckConfig extends cdktf.TerraformMetaArguments {
/**
* How often (in seconds) to send a health check. The default value is 5
* seconds.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#check_interval_sec ComputeHealthCheck#check_interval_sec}
*/
readonly checkIntervalSec?: number;
/**
* An optional description of this resource. Provide this property when
* you create the resource.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#description ComputeHealthCheck#description}
*/
readonly description?: string;
/**
* A so-far unhealthy instance will be marked healthy after this many
* consecutive successes. The default value is 2.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#healthy_threshold ComputeHealthCheck#healthy_threshold}
*/
readonly healthyThreshold?: number;
/**
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#id ComputeHealthCheck#id}
*
* Please be aware that the id field is automatically added to all resources in Terraform providers using a Terraform provider SDK version below 2.
* If you experience problems setting this value it might not be settable. Please take a look at the provider documentation to ensure it should be settable.
*/
readonly id?: string;
/**
* Name of the resource. Provided by the client when the resource is
* created. The name must be 1-63 characters long, and comply with
* RFC1035. Specifically, the name must be 1-63 characters long and
* match the regular expression '[a-z]([-a-z0-9]*[a-z0-9])?' which means
* the first character must be a lowercase letter, and all following
* characters must be a dash, lowercase letter, or digit, except the
* last character, which cannot be a dash.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#name ComputeHealthCheck#name}
*/
readonly name: string;
/**
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#project ComputeHealthCheck#project}
*/
readonly project?: string;
/**
* The list of cloud regions from which health checks are performed. If
* any regions are specified, then exactly 3 regions should be specified.
* The region names must be valid names of Google Cloud regions. This can
* only be set for global health check. If this list is non-empty, then
* there are restrictions on what other health check fields are supported
* and what other resources can use this health check:
*
* * SSL, HTTP2, and GRPC protocols are not supported.
*
* * The TCP request field is not supported.
*
* * The proxyHeader field for HTTP, HTTPS, and TCP is not supported.
*
* * The checkIntervalSec field must be at least 30.
*
* * The health check cannot be used with BackendService nor with managed
* instance group auto-healing.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#source_regions ComputeHealthCheck#source_regions}
*/
readonly sourceRegions?: string[];
/**
* How long (in seconds) to wait before claiming failure.
* The default value is 5 seconds. It is invalid for timeoutSec to have
* greater value than checkIntervalSec.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#timeout_sec ComputeHealthCheck#timeout_sec}
*/
readonly timeoutSec?: number;
/**
* A so-far healthy instance will be marked unhealthy after this many
* consecutive failures. The default value is 2.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#unhealthy_threshold ComputeHealthCheck#unhealthy_threshold}
*/
readonly unhealthyThreshold?: number;
/**
* grpc_health_check block
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#grpc_health_check ComputeHealthCheck#grpc_health_check}
*/
readonly grpcHealthCheck?: ComputeHealthCheckGrpcHealthCheck;
/**
* http2_health_check block
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#http2_health_check ComputeHealthCheck#http2_health_check}
*/
readonly http2HealthCheck?: ComputeHealthCheckHttp2HealthCheck;
/**
* http_health_check block
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#http_health_check ComputeHealthCheck#http_health_check}
*/
readonly httpHealthCheck?: ComputeHealthCheckHttpHealthCheck;
/**
* https_health_check block
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#https_health_check ComputeHealthCheck#https_health_check}
*/
readonly httpsHealthCheck?: ComputeHealthCheckHttpsHealthCheck;
/**
* log_config block
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#log_config ComputeHealthCheck#log_config}
*/
readonly logConfig?: ComputeHealthCheckLogConfig;
/**
* ssl_health_check block
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#ssl_health_check ComputeHealthCheck#ssl_health_check}
*/
readonly sslHealthCheck?: ComputeHealthCheckSslHealthCheck;
/**
* tcp_health_check block
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#tcp_health_check ComputeHealthCheck#tcp_health_check}
*/
readonly tcpHealthCheck?: ComputeHealthCheckTcpHealthCheck;
/**
* timeouts block
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#timeouts ComputeHealthCheck#timeouts}
*/
readonly timeouts?: ComputeHealthCheckTimeouts;
}
export interface ComputeHealthCheckGrpcHealthCheck {
/**
* The gRPC service name for the health check.
* The value of grpcServiceName has the following meanings by convention:
* - Empty serviceName means the overall status of all services at the backend.
* - Non-empty serviceName means the health of that gRPC service, as defined by the owner of the service.
* The grpcServiceName can only be ASCII.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#grpc_service_name ComputeHealthCheck#grpc_service_name}
*/
readonly grpcServiceName?: string;
/**
* The port number for the health check request.
* Must be specified if portName and portSpecification are not set
* or if port_specification is USE_FIXED_PORT. Valid values are 1 through 65535.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#port ComputeHealthCheck#port}
*/
readonly port?: number;
/**
* Port name as defined in InstanceGroup#NamedPort#name. If both port and
* port_name are defined, port takes precedence.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#port_name ComputeHealthCheck#port_name}
*/
readonly portName?: string;
/**
* Specifies how port is selected for health checking, can be one of the
* following values:
*
* * 'USE_FIXED_PORT': The port number in 'port' is used for health checking.
*
* * 'USE_NAMED_PORT': The 'portName' is used for health checking.
*
* * 'USE_SERVING_PORT': For NetworkEndpointGroup, the port specified for each
* network endpoint is used for health checking. For other backends, the
* port or named port specified in the Backend Service is used for health
* checking.
*
* If not specified, gRPC health check follows behavior specified in 'port' and
* 'portName' fields. Possible values: ["USE_FIXED_PORT", "USE_NAMED_PORT", "USE_SERVING_PORT"]
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/compute_health_check#port_specification ComputeHealthCheck#port_specification}
*/
readonly portSpecification?: string;
}
